Web1,2-Diaminocyclohexane is an organic compound with the formula (CH 2) 4 (CHNH 2) 2. It is a mixture of three stereoisomers: cis -1,2-diaminocyclohexane and both enantiomers of trans -1,2-diaminocyclohexane. The mixture is a colorless, corrosive liquid, although older samples can appear yellow. It is often called DCH-99 and also DACH. Solvent bonding is one of several methods of adhesive bonding for joining plastics. Application of a solvent to a thermoplastic material softens the polymer, and with applied pressure this results in polymer chain interdiffusion at the bonding junction. WebA-values are numerical values used in the determination of the most stable orientation of atoms in a molecule ( conformational analysis ), as well as a general representation of steric bulk. A-values are derived from energy measurements of the different cyclohexane conformations of a monosubstituted cyclohexane chemical. WebCyclohexanol is the organic compound with the formula HOCH (CH 2) 5. The molecule is related to cyclohexane by replacement of one hydrogen atom by a hydroxyl group. [4] This compound exists as a deliquescent colorless solid with a camphor-like odor, which, when very pure, melts near room temperature. WebBromocyclohexane (also called cyclohexyl bromide, abbreviated CXB) is an organic compound with the chemical formula C 6 H 11 Br. It is used to match the refractive index of PMMA for example in confocal microscopy of colloids. A mixture of cis - decalin and CXB can simultaneously match optical index and density of PMMA. [1]
